Looks like you're using an old version of eol-conversion.el that tries to
add an entry to the "mule" menu (which no longer exists in emacs 21).

> I downloaded and attempted to load version 21.2 this AM. I am using the
> Win32 binaries and with running runemacs.exe --debug-init, I get the
> following:
>
> Debugger entered--Lisp error: (wrong-type-argument keymapp nil)
> define-key(nil [menu-bar mule] ("mule" keymap "mule"))
> byte-code("Æ?,T
> easy-menu-get-map(nil ("mule" "--" nil )
> easy-menu-add-item(nil, ("mule") "")
> byte-code( "")
> require (eol-conversion)
>
> I did some google searching, but didn't find my answer. Anyone have any
> ideas?
>
> I am running:
> GNU Emacs 21.2.1 (i386-msvc-nt5.0.2195) of 2002-03-19 on buffy
> On Windows 2000 SP2.
